![]() Swallow the extended-release capsule whole and do not crush, chew, break, or open it. You may take this medicine with or without food, first thing in the morning. Selling or giving away this medicine is against the law. Keep the medication in a place where others cannot get to it. Misuse can cause addiction, overdose, or death. Use the medicine exactly as directed.Īmphetamine and dextroamphetamine may be habit-forming. ![]() Your doctor may occasionally change your dose. Not every brand of amphetamine and dextroamphetamine is for use in the same age group of children.įollow all directions on your prescription label and read all medication guides or instruction sheets. You should not breast-feed while you are using this medicine.ĭo not give this medicine to a child without medical advice. Tell your doctor if you are pregnant or plan to become pregnant. You may have blood circulation problems that can cause numbness, pain, or discoloration in your fingers or toes.Ĭall your doctor right away if you have: signs of heart problems-chest pain, feeling light-headed or short of breath signs of psychosis-paranoia, aggression, new behavior problems, seeing or hearing things that are not real signs of circulation problems-unexplained wounds on your fingers or toes. Stimulants have caused stroke, heart attack, and sudden death in people with high blood pressure, heart disease, or a heart defect.ĭo not use this medicine if you have used an MAO inhibitor in the past 14 days, such as isocarboxazid, linezolid, methylene blue injection, phenelzine, rasagiline, selegiline, or tranylcypromine.Īmphetamine and dextroamphetamine may cause new or worsening psychosis (unusual thoughts or behavior), especially if you have a history of depression, mental illness, or bipolar disorder.
